Primary Culture And Identification Of The Olfactory Ensheathing Cell In Muscle Basal Lamina Tissue Engineering Scaffolds From Adult Rats

1. Objective:To observed the multiplication of the olfactory ensheathing cell planting in muscle basal lamina(MBL)2. Method:Choose10both male and female littermate and24month of age SD rats to obtain the bilateral olfactory bulbs and olfactory mucosa at1/3nasal septum, Purify the olfactory ensheathing cells(OECs) from olfactory bulbs and olfactory mucosa according to differing rates of attachment of the various harvested cells types and arabinosylcytosin method. Forskolin and bFGF were added into the cultures. Hochest33342marked the purification of OECs transfer in muscle MBL praper with the chemical and physical approach. To observe the3、5、7、9days OECs in MBL biological scaffolds cultured in vitro for chemical identification.3. Conclusion:Blue sign Marked different source of OECs with hochest33342were implanted the MBL biological scaffold multi-cultured5day were distributed evenly in the MBL in immuno fluorescence microscope, the MBL of OECs were multi-cultured7days density higher than5days, cultivate to9days, observe the MBL OCEs density within the7days has no obvious change, and two different source of OECs no difference.4. Discussion:From adult rat olfactory bulb, cultivate the nasal mucous membrane separation and purification of olfactory ensheathing cells implanted in muscle membrane tube joint training, training to olfactory ensheathing cells in muscle membrane tube, on the7th of olfactory ensheathing cells density peak is in phase balance, are no longer as density increased with the extension of incubation time.
